2024年第十四届MathorCup数学应用挑战赛C题解析(更新中)

2024年第十四届MathorCup数学应用挑战赛C题解析(更新中)

  • 题目
  • 题目解析(更新中)
    • 问题一
    • 问题二
    • 问题三

题目

                  C题 物流网络分拣中心货量预测及人员排班

电商物流网络在订单履约中由多个环节组成,图1是一个简化的物流
网络示意图。其中,分拣中心作为网络的中间环节,需要将包裹按照不同
流向进行分拣并发往下一个场地,最终使包裹到达消费者手中。分拣中心
管理效率的提升,对整体网络的履约效率和运作成本起着十分重要的作用。在这里插入图片描述
分拣中心的货量预测是电商物流网络重要的研究问题,对分拣中心货
量的精准预测是后续管理及决策的基础,如果管理者可以提前预知之后一
段时间各个分拣中心需要操作的货量,便可以提前对资源进行安排。在此
场景下的货量预测目标一般有两个:一是根据历史货量、物流网络配置等
信息,预测每个分拣中心每天的货量;二是根据历史货量小时数据,预测
每个分拣中心每小时的货量。
分拣中心的货量预测与网络的运输线路有关,通过分析各线路的运输
货量,可以得出各分拣中心之间的网络连接关系。当线路关系调整时,可
以参考线路的调整信息,得到各分拣中心货量更为准确的预测。
基于分拣中心货量预测的人员排班是接下来要解决的重要问题,分拣
中心的人员包含正式工和临时工两种:正式工是场地长期雇佣的人员,工
作效率较高;临时工是根据货量情况临时招募的人员,每天可以任意增减,
但工作效率相对较低、雇佣成本较高。根据货量预测结果合理安排人员,
旨在完成工作的情况下尽可能降低人员成本。针对当前物流网络,其人员
安排班次及小时人效指标情况如下:
1)对于所有分拣中心,每天分为6个班次,分别为: 00:00-08:00,
05:00-1 3:00,08:00- 16:00,12:00-20:00, 14:00-22:00, 16:00-24:00,
每个人员(正式工或临时工)每天只能出勤一个班次;
2)小时人效指标为每人每小时完成分拣的包裹量(包裹量即货量),正
式工的最高小时人效为25包裹/小时,临时工的最高小时人效为20
包裹/小时。
该物流网络包括57个分拣中心,每个分拣中心过去4个月的每天货量
如附件1所示,过去30天的每小时货量如附件2所示。基于以上数据,请
完成以下问题:

问题1:建立货量预测模型,对57个分拣中心未来30天每天及每小
时的货量进行预测,将预测结果写入结果表1和表2中。

问题2:过去90天各分拣中心之间的各运输线路平均货量如附件3所
示。若未来30天分拣中心之间的运输线路发生了变化,具体如附件4所示。
根据附件1-4,请对57个分拣中心未来30天每天及每小时的货量进行预测,
并将预测结果写入结果表3和表4中。

问题3:假设每个分拣中心有60名正式工,在人员安排时将优先使用
正式工,若需额外人员将使用临时工。请基于问题2的预测结果建立模型,
给出未来30天每个分拣中心每个班次的出勤人数,并写入结果表5中。要
求在每天的货量处理完成的基础.上,安排的人天数(例如30天每天出勤
200名员工,则总人天数为6000) 尽可能少,且每天的实际小时人效尽量
均衡。

问题4:研究特定分拣中心的排班问题,这里不妨以SC60为例,假设
分拣中心SC60当前有200名正式工,请基于问题2的预测结果建立模型,
确定未来30天每名正式工及临时工的班次出勤计划,即给出未来30天每
天六个班次中,每名正式工将在哪些班次出勤,每个班次需要雇佣多少临
时工,并写入结果表6中。每名正式工的出勤率(出勤的天数除以总天数
30)不能高于85%,且连续出勤天数不能超过7天。要求在每天货量处理
完成的基础上,安排的人天数尽可能少,每天的实际小时人效尽量均衡,
且正式工出勤率尽量均衡。

题目解析(更新中)

问题一

问题二

问题三

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/539522.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

状态模式:管理对象状态转换的动态策略

在软件开发中,状态模式是一种行为型设计模式,它允许一个对象在其内部状态改变时改变它的行为。这种模式把与特定状态相关的行为局部化,并且将不同状态的行为分散到对应的状态类中,使得状态和行为可以独立变化。本文将详细介绍状态…

ActiveMQ 01 消息中间件jmsMQ

消息中间件之ActiveMQ 01 什么是JMS MQ 全称:Java MessageService 中文:Java 消息服务。 JMS 是 Java 的一套 API 标准,最初的目的是为了使应用程序能够访问现有的 MOM 系 统(MOM 是 MessageOriented Middleware 的英文缩写&am…

django基于python的法院执法案件管理系统

本课题使用Python语言进行开发。代码层面的操作主要在PyCharm中进行,将系统所使用到的表以及数据存储到MySQL数据库中,方便对数据进行操作本课题基于WEB的开发平台,设计的基本思路是: 框架:django/flask 后端&#xff…

LwIP 之八 详解 IP RAW 编程、示例、API 源码、数据流

我们最为熟知的网络通信程序接口应该是 Socket。LwIP 自然也提供了 Socket 编程接口,不过,LwIP 的 Socket 编程接口都是使用最底层的接口来实现的。我们这里要学习的 IP RAW 编程则是指的直接使用 LwIP 的提供的 RAW API 来直接实现应用层功能。这里先来一张图,对 LwIP 内部…

【Godot4自学手册】第三十六节圆形移动或扇形移动的铁球

在第三十四节我实现了来回无限滚动的伤害铁刺球,这一节我准备实现一个圆形移动或扇形移动,并带有链条的铁球。效果如下: 一、实现原理 绕一点做圆周运动,简单的说就是: 每一帧根据旋转的角度计算出下一个位置的坐标…

【c++leetcode】14. Longest Common Prefix

问题入口 解决方案 class Solution { public:string longestCommonPrefix(vector<string>& v) {string ans "";sort(v.begin(), v.end());int n v.size();string first v[0],last v[n - 1];for(int i 0; i < min(first.size(),last.size()); i){…

实现网站图片水印

要实现网站图片水印&#xff0c;有几种方式&#xff1a;1、对于自己想要上传图片先通过某些软件增加水印&#xff0c;然后再上传到图片服务器。2、通过上传客户端&#xff08;eg&#xff1a;picgo&#xff09;功能或插件直接自动水印以及上传服务器。本文主要聚焦于第二种方式&…

前端重置表单的多个Demo

目录 前言1. 纯重置2. reset重置3. resetFields重置4. 彩蛋 前言 由于从Java转全栈&#xff0c;对于前端的相关知识目前 以点科普面&#xff0c;此处的总结 重置前端表单内容&#xff0c;防止影响后续操作 其基本知识只需要通过点击按钮触发重置表单 1. 纯重置 可以通过按钮…

跟TED演讲学英文:The exciting, perilous journey toward AGI by Ilya Sutskever

The exciting, perilous journey toward AGI Link: https://www.ted.com/talks/ilya_sutskever_the_exciting_perilous_journey_toward_agi? Speaker: Ilya Sutskever Date: October 2023 文章目录 The exciting, perilous journey toward AGIIntroductionVocabularyTranscr…

修改cmd默认编码(win10系统) 亲测有效

win10系统,CMD默认字符编码序号是936,输入"chcp"命令可以看到此编号,右键cmd窗口–属性,同样也可以看到此编号.如下图: 我需要把字符编码序号936变更为65001,即UTF-8编码. 网上搜到的教程主要有两种: 教程一修改注册表的方法:https://learnku.com/articles/55553 测…

Ubuntu (Linux系统) 下载安装 Qt 环境

在官网http://download.qt.io/archive/qt/ 下载安装包&#xff0c;默认linux平台下提供的安装包以run后缀结尾 也可以选择其它地址下载 Qt官网下载地址&#xff1a;https://download.qt.io&#xff1b; 国内镜像下载地址&#xff1a;https://mirrors.cloud.tencent.com/qt/ 。建…

Alterac Valley

Alterac Valley 奥特兰克山谷 不要怕死&#xff0c;冲就对了&#xff0c;为了部落&#xff01;&#xff01;&#xff01;55级的我未来就是这个服务器的督军&#xff0c;跟我冲啊

实战解析:SpringBoot AOP与Redis结合实现延时双删功能

目录 一、业务场景 1、此时存在的问题 2、解决方案 3、为何要延时500毫秒&#xff1f; 4、为何要两次删除缓存&#xff1f; 二、代码实践 1、引入Redis和SpringBoot AOP依赖 2、编写自定义aop注解和切面 3、application.yml 4、user.sql脚本 5、UserController 6、U…

test4131

欢迎关注博主 Mindtechnist 或加入【Linux C/C/Python社区】一起学习和分享Linux、C、C、Python、Matlab&#xff0c;机器人运动控制、多机器人协作&#xff0c;智能优化算法&#xff0c;滤波估计、多传感器信息融合&#xff0c;机器学习&#xff0c;人工智能等相关领域的知识和…

316_C++_xml文件解析成map,可以放到表格上 + xml、xlsx文件互相解析

xml文件例如&#xff1a; <?xml version"1.0" encoding"UTF-8" standalone"yes"?> <TrTable> <tr id"0" label"TR_PB_CH" text"CH%2"/> <tr id"4" label"TR_PB_CHN"…

antDesignVue 使用-持续更新

背景 vue3viteantdesignvuevue-router 1,全局完整注册 1.1下载antdesignvue npm i --save ant-design-vue 或者 npm install ant-design-vuenext --save 1.2在mian.ts中引入 import { createApp } from vue import { createPinia } from piniaimport App from ./App.vue …

【Canvas与艺术】旋转弯曲色带效果(类似曲叶电风扇)

【关键点】 用复数计算得到贝塞尔二次曲线的控制点 【效果图】 【核心代码】 // 偏转角 const bias(Math.PI/9); var xbMath.cos(bias); var ybMath.sin(bias);// 画曲线电风扇 for(var i0;i<12;i){var starti*Math.PI/6this.theta;var x1250*Math.cos(start);var y1250*M…

什么是态势感知?

什么是态势感知&#xff1f; 同学&#xff0c;听说过态势感知吗&#xff1f;啥&#xff1f;不知道&#xff1f;不知道很正常&#xff0c;因为态势感知是一个比较小众、比较神秘的概念。为什么态势感知很神秘&#xff0c;首先是因为这是来自军事情报领域的概念&#xff0c;然后…

Power BI报告在PPT中实时刷新的实现技巧分享

前面我们刚介绍了如何在PPT中展示Power BI报告&#xff1f; 很巧的是&#xff0c;在刚刚的Power BI 2024年4月更新的诸多新特性中&#xff0c;PPT中使用的Power BI插件又有新特性的更新&#xff0c;数据自动刷新功能(新特性仅限国际版使用)&#xff0c;这个新特性支持最低15秒…

【无标题】前缀和和差分

前缀和 一维前缀和 #include <vector> ​ class Code01_PrefixSumArray { public:class NumArray {public:std::vector<int> sum; ​NumArray(std::vector<int>& nums) {sum.resize(nums.size() 1);for (int i 1; i < nums.size(); i) {sum[i] su…